Elizabeth Manget Williamson departed this life on January 18, 2006 at Baylor University Hospital, having lived in Dallas most of her 94 years. She is survived by three children, thirteen grandchildren and fourteen great-grandchildren. All remember her as a loving, devoted mother and grandmother, bright and full of good humor. Educated at Hockaday school, she graduated in 1928. She graduated from Vassar College in 1933. She married C.R. Smith, CEO of American Airlines in 1934. After a divorce, she married W.E. Walker of Dallas, an independent oil operator, in 1944. Mr. Walker died in 1971. She married Edward A. Williamson, a Warner Brothers executive, in 1975. Mr. Williamson died in 2003. Mrs. Williamson was a long time devoted member of the Episcopal Church of the Incarnation. She volunteered with the local chapter of the American Red Cross during World War Two and remained an enthusiastic volunteer for the years. She lunched with Red Cross friends only a few weeks ago. She also volunteered in the gift shop at Children's Medical Center. Mrs. Williamson's other activities included membership in the Shakespeare Club, the Hesitation dance club, and Coon Creek Club of Athens. She was a Junior League Sustainer. . . .
